    Default yay, i made money this time.

    i should consider this my proper 'first night', heh. i tried my luck at a largish nude place since they are always hard up for girls, and i did tolerably well, since i only had a couple of customers. i did my first ever lap dances and they were exhausting, but it was fun to get naked and get paid for it, too. i will give this place a few weeks and build my stamina up and see how that goes. i know topless is the most money potential overall, but i keep freaking out so much just at the door, it's probably best to work somewhere lower-pressure and practice my sellling and dancing techniques until they're polished enough for the higher-pressure topless places. it's kind of a relief knowing i have a chance of doing ok at this, if i just take my time and ease myself into the whole thing.

    i also got a lot of 'you're too pretty/classy/smart/etc to be here', but everyone that said that paid me some money for the night, so i can't complain about it. the managers are pretty chill, and as long as i put in a few hours on days for a few weeks, i never have to worry about tipping out anyone but the dj. that means a lot of time there, but also a lot of time to practice.

    the girls were all really super helpful and nice. i look forward to tomorrow, anyhow. i just need some blasted no-stick pads; i really can't believe i forgot those. i was slipsliding all over the stage. also, i have to thank all the girls posting to this site with tips on how to get more dances-- i tried some of that stuff and it worked.
